隨著互聯網的發展,SEO從業者們對于蜘蛛爬蟲也愈加重視。目前網絡上有許多蜘蛛池程序,能夠幫助站長加速搜索引擎結果中自己網站的排名,今天我們就來了解一下蜘蛛池程序的原理和用途。
蜘蛛池程序大致可以分為兩類:一類是“自抓”型,即存放在自己的服務器上,自行爬取網頁來生成數據;另一類是“代抓”型,即通過代表這兩種程序運行的網站向需要的站點進行爬取。關于這兩種類型,我們先來介紹一下自抓型的蜘蛛池程序的原理。
蜘蛛池程序的運行是需要一些基礎設施的。首先需要有一些服務器,以及一個暫時存儲數據的空間(一般是數據庫)。其次,要推動它的運作還需要最主要的資源——網絡帶寬,千萬不要低估了C段IP。(一個合格的蜘蛛池程序,需要一萬多個不重復C段IP)
了解了這些基礎知識之后,我們再來看一下自抓型蜘蛛池程序的原理:當一個自抓型蜘蛛池程序被啟動后,它會利用自己的帶寬等資源,從各大搜索引擎和瀏覽器中獲取爬蟲完成的數據,進而形成有用的搜索引擎離線數據。我們可以將收集到的數據與一些特殊的算法結合起來,從而輸出高效、精確、可重度高并且有用的數據。
蜘蛛池程序具有多種用途,不同的人根據需求也會使用不同的工具。不過大致可以歸納為以下幾種:
對于SEO工程師,蜘蛛池程序可以幫助他們進行更好的頁面優化。此外,隨著各家搜索引擎的深入發展,地址展示、位置的排名、排名花費密度等問題也日漸變得復雜起來,并且在一些特定情況下,精確的排名數據量明顯增加。
對于競品研究者,可通過蜘蛛池程序收集競品的數據進行篩選,從而分析不同公司/企業的產品信息、新聞報道、口碑,并對此進行反饋和構建自己的關鍵詞體系。
對于數據挖掘/報表分析師,蜘蛛池程序提供了一個快速建立自己的競爭體系和畫像的平臺。可以根據零售成本、易用性、交互設計方面的特色等因素來進行排序和對比。在這個過程中,收集到的數據也可以通過轄及率、收錄數等指標的統計數據來提高分析的精度。
蜘蛛池程序作為一種輔助站長進行SEO優化的工具,已經成為SEO從業人員的不可或缺的結構。通過介紹蜘蛛池程序的原理和用途,相信大家對蜘蛛池程序的認識有了更進一步的了解,同時,使用蜘蛛池程序的時候也需要謹慎使用。只有選擇了適合自己的工具,才能為自己的網站排名走向取得更加顯著的支持。